E. A. Stewart Lumber Corporation
E. A. Stewart, of Dallas, had extensive sawmilling in Arkansas and Texas sawmilling. Stewart operated mills in and north of Texarkana and Maud, and in the Texas counties of Houston, Anderson, Titus, Red River, Morris, and Bowie. Several of the Red River County mills were small, portable operations, thus they will be noted only here. Consolidating his holdings in 1946, Stewart established the E. A. Stewart Hardwood Lumber Company, with offices at Texarkana.
In 1947, E. A. Stewart was milling lumber and making sash, doors, and blinds at Maud. The Directory of Texas Manufacturers 1956-1958 reported that the E. A. Stewart Lumber Corporation opened at Maud in 1945. The company employed more than a 100 workers manufacturing lumber, hardwood floorings, furniture dimension stock, ties, and car stock.
